Спецификации
| Атрибут | Ценность |
| Package | Tape & Reel (TR),Cut Tape (CT) |
| ProductStatus | Active |
| DiodeType | Standard |
| Voltage-DCReverse(Vr)(Max) | 1000 V |
| Current-AverageRectified(Io) | 1A |
| Voltage-Forward(Vf)(Max)@If | 1.1 V @ 1 A |
| Speed | Standard Recovery >500ns, > 200mA (Io) |
| ReverseRecoveryTime(trr) | 1.8 µs |
| Current-ReverseLeakage@Vr | 5 µA @ 1000 V |
| Capacitance@VrF | 12pF @ 4V, 1MHz |
| MountingType | Surface Mount |
| Package/Case | DO-214AC, SMA |
| SupplierDevicePackage | DO-214AC (SMA) |
